  • When receiving email, Thunderbird freezes and displays "Not Responding" in screen header. Adds popstate folder to account.

    I'm running Thunderbird 31.6.0 on Windows 8.1 with BitDefender 2013.
    PROBLEM:
    When getting email, Thunderbird freezes and displays "Not Responding" in screen header.
    When TB is closed then reopened, a popstate folder (popstate-1.dat) is added to account. A new popstate folder appears with each crash/freeze, and as long as they are not deleted, they pile up with unique numbers (popstate-1.dat, popstate-2.dat, etc.).
    (see attached screenshot)
    NOTE: I've included troubleshooting details below for all the fixes I tried, thinking it might be helpful to anyone who has a similar problem and is thinking about going down those paths. Ultimately, it seems that FIX ATTEMPT 5 is the winner.
    ==================================
    FIX ATTEMPT 1:
    Following the suggestion in this archived mozilla support post: https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/questions/1026288, I restarted Thunderbird in Safe Mode (Help > Restart with Add-Ons disabled...), checking the "Disable all add-ons" and "Reset toolbars and controls" and clicking "Make Changes and Restart" button.
    In Add-Ons Manager, BitDefender Toolbar now appears to be disabled.
    (see attached screenshot)
    But the problem persists.
    FIX ATTEMPT 2:
    Following the suggestion in this archived mozilla support post: https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/questions/1016811, I clicked Help > Troubleshooting Information > Show Folder button. This opens a File Explorer window for 3I58b9dq.default (this is the "profile" folder) which contains panacea.dat and folderTree.json files.
    I changed file names to panacea-changed.dat and folderTree-changed.json (rather than deleting them, in case I need to restore them), and I reopened Thunderbird.
    This did not solve the problem -- and, furthermore, the profile folder seems to have automatically generated new panacea.dat and folderTree.json files to replace those for which I changed the filenames.
    FIX ATTEMPT 3:
    Following the suggestion in this mozilla support post: https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/questions/1044774, I restarted Windows 8.1 in safe mode with networking enabled (using these instructions: http://www.howtogeek.com/107511/how-to-boot-into-safe-mode-on-windows-8-the-easy-way/.)
    TB does not crash when Windows runs in safe mode, but the aspect ratio of my display is distorted; everything's really big and stretched horizontally, and my two displays are mirrored rather than extended. Running Windows perpetually in safe mode is not the ideal fix.
    QUESTION 1: I understand that troubleshooting is supposedly done best in safe mode — What might I do in safe mode to diagnose the Thunderbird problem?
    FIX ATTEMPT 4:
    This article https://wiki.mozilla.org/Thunderbird:Testing:Antivirus_Related_Performance_Issues#Symptoms, suggests that problems with Thunderbird associated with BitDefender can be solved by uninstalling and re-installing BitDefender.
    Not really comfortable uninstalling and re-installing, I disabled Bitdefender (Settings button > Antivirus button > Shield tab > On-Access Scanning toggle Off) to see if that would work. It did not fix the problem.
    QUESTION 2: Would uninstalling BitDefender be any different than disabling it?
    FIX ATTEMPT 5:
    Create a Bitdefender Exclusion for the Thunderbird folder:
    Settings button > Antivirus button > Exclusions tab > Excluded files and folders link > Add button > navigate to Thunderbird folder (c:\users\username\appdata\roaming\thunderbird) > Both radio button > Add button > OK button
    THIS FIX DID THE TRICK! YAY!

    FIX ATTEMPT #5 above did the trick, and now I see that it was the chosen solution for a similar post of the same problem at https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/questions/1044774

  • S10 would not boot, blank screen, hardware problem??

    hello all,
    my s10 was working perfectly the previous night, but the next day when i press the power button, the screen was blank.
    When I press the power button, the blue light came on to indicate power, and also the wireless light came on.
    The fan also started up, but then it turns off, leaving a blank screen, it seems nothing was booting or working except for those 2 lights. I have tried it with battery in and out and also with AC. But it still doesn't work.
    Is it a hardware (like maybe circuit or harddrive) problem? As when I decide to hold down and press on power button when i found out is not working, the screen flickers and the computer shuts down.
    I got some important school work, last yr of high school, hopefully someone can help me to get my computer running again, is only 5 months old =[
    Thank you, canicecy =] 

    I will propose you something close to one thing done but slightly different and tried (and worked) many times and with many different laptops having the same issue as yours. You need to Reset any possible electrostatic Charge.
    take off the battery and the power cable (this means no contact to any current)
    press continuously the power button for 10 seconds.
    plug back everything and retry
    if it persists you can try it a second time but if after this it's still the same you must call the hotline and repair you unit as long as you are under warranty.

  • Caller display not worked since June 2014

    On 26/06/14 I reported a fault (VOL-**********) that the caller display function had stopped working following a thunderstorm in the area. According to the fault status this fault is showing as being corrected and closed on 02/07/14 when in fact the fault still exists. I tested the line using the BT test socket with a new BT2000 phone and this displayed ‘incoming call’ therefore my internal wiring is not part of the problem. I have also dialled the test code *#234# to check if the caller display service is available and confirmed that it is. I then tested the new BT2000 phone on the neighbour’s telephone line and this showed the caller ID for incoming calls, as did my other telephone as well; therefore none of the telephone handsets are at fault. Three times BT have informed me that the fault has been fixed and yet I still have no caller display. Reading through the forums it would appear that other people have encountered similar issues and that the problem is at the exchange, “An Openreach engineer discovered that the RS232 burst transferring the CLI number up the line was too weak and he then went down to the exchange to investigate. He then discovered that the fault lay in the ADSL device which lies between the analogue exchange equipment and the outgoing line”. 
    I’m surprised to see that BT are taking so long to trace a fault in their system last raised 5/8/2014 (VOL012-**********) and that they haven’t sent an engineer to the property or to the exchange to check the problem.
    My patience is wearing thin over this problem with my Caller Display not working as it started in mid June. I’m also becoming less enthusiastic about BT and find it harder to recommend them to others.
    My last message from BT, tells me that it should be back to normal on the 8 August. However, it is still not working. Their message that my phone should be back to normal now and if it isn’t report this to BT, is ridiculous. If an engineer had investigated what was causing the fault and found it, then he would have fixed it. However, either an engineer has not investigated the fault or BT is not competent in fixing their own service faults and makes these statements with crossed fingers?

    An engineer called yesterday and told me that he had been asked to test the line for a voice fault not a Caller Display fault. However, his testing revealed there is no line fault, CLI signal is strong and he was happy that the new BT2000 phone (bought after the lightning strike) is working properly. (This phone had also been tested on a neighbour’s phone line where it displayed the callers number). He also found that this same BT2000 phone on my line was not displaying the Caller’s number (CLI), but couldn’t offer any reason why.
    I conjectured with him that these tests must bring the problem down to a corrupted CLI signal which does not allow the phone to understand the phone number being sent.
